What Is Die Cutting?
Before we explore the different types of die-cutting machines, it's important to understand the die cutting process itself. Die cutting involves using a specialized tool (the "die") to cut out specific shapes or designs from materials such as paper, cardboard, fabric, or plastic. The die, which is usually made of steel or another hard metal, is shaped to the desired design, and when pressure is applied, it cuts through the material with precision.
The die cutting process is highly beneficial for mass production, as it allows manufacturers to produce large quantities of the same item in a short period.
1. Manual Die Cutting Machines
What Are Manual Die Cutting Machines?
Manual die cutting machines are operated by hand, and they typically require the user to apply physical force to cut the material. These machines are often compact, portable, and ideal for small-scale projects and hobbyists. They are commonly used in craft applications such as scrapbooking, card making, and fabric cutting.
How Do Manual Die Cutting Machines Work?
Manual machines typically consist of a metal platform, a handle, and a die-cutting mechanism. The user places a die and the material (e.g., paper or fabric) onto the platform and then turns the handle to apply pressure, which cuts the material according to the die's design.
Pros and Cons of Manual Die Cutting Machines
Pros:
Affordable – They are less expensive compared to automated machines.
Easy to Use – Simple and intuitive operation.
Portability – Smaller and easier to store or transport.
Cons:
Limited Cutting Capacity – Best suited for smaller materials and projects.
Time-Consuming – Requires more manual effort, especially for large-scale production.
2. Electric Die Cutting Machines
What Are Electric Die Cutting Machines?
Electric die cutting machines are powered by electricity, making them a step up from manual models. These machines offer enhanced efficiency and can cut through a wider variety of materials with more speed and precision.
How Do Electric Die Cutting Machines Work?
Electric machines work similarly to manual ones, except the cutting process is automated. The user places the material and die into the machine, and with the press of a button or the use of a foot pedal, the machine automatically applies pressure to cut the material.
Pros and Cons of Electric Die Cutting Machines
Pros:
Faster Operation – Cuts materials more quickly than manual machines.
Less Physical Effort – Requires less manual input, making it easier for users with limited strength or stamina.
More Versatile – Can cut a broader range of materials with ease.

3. Hydraulic Die Cutting Machines
What Are Hydraulic Die Cutting Machines?
Hydraulic die cutting machines are a type of industrial die cutting machine that uses hydraulic pressure to cut through materials. These machines are known for their strength and ability to cut through thicker materials, such as rubber, foam, and leather.
How Do Hydraulic Die Cutting Machines Work?
In hydraulic die cutting machines, fluid (usually oil) is pumped into a cylinder, which activates the cutting die. The hydraulic pressure provides immense force, allowing for precise and efficient cutting of even tough materials.
Pros and Cons of Hydraulic Die Cutting Machines
Pros:
High Cutting Power – Capable of cutting through thicker and tougher materials.
Precise Cutting – Known for delivering high precision with minimal wear.
High Efficiency – Ideal for large-scale, heavy-duty applications.

4. Rotational Die Cutting Machines
What Are Rotational Die Cutting Machines?
Rotational die cutting machines utilize rotary dies instead of flat dies to cut materials. The rotary dies spin continuously to cut through the material, providing a high-speed, continuous cutting process.
How Do Rotational Die Cutting Machines Work?
In rotational die cutting, the material is fed through a rotating drum or cylinder that is fitted with a rotary die. The material is passed between the die and an anvil roll, where pressure is applied to cut the material into the desired shape.
Pros and Cons of Rotational Die Cutting Machines
Pros:
Speed – Capable of producing large volumes quickly.
Continuous Production – Ideal for high-volume, repetitive production processes.
Precision – Offers excellent cutting precision for intricate designs.

5. Laser Die Cutting Machines
What Are Laser Die Cutting Machines?
Laser die cutting machines use focused laser beams to cut through materials with incredible precision. These machines are typically used for cutting intricate designs and patterns in a wide variety of materials.
How Do Laser Die Cutting Machines Work?
Laser cutting machines focus a high-powered laser beam onto the material's surface, which melts or vaporizes the material, leaving behind the desired cut. The process is computer-controlled, allowing for intricate and detailed designs.
Pros and Cons of Laser Die Cutting Machines
Pros:
High Precision – Offers the highest level of cutting accuracy, ideal for intricate designs.
No Physical Die Required – Unlike traditional die cutting, there is no need for a physical die, making it versatile.
Clean Edges – Produces smooth, clean cuts without the need for further finishing.

6. Flatbed Die Cutting Machines
What Are Flatbed Die Cutting Machines?
Flatbed die cutting machines feature a large, flat bed on which the material is placed and cut. These machines are often used in industrial and manufacturing settings, particularly for cutting large sheets of material like paper, cardboard, and foam.
How Do Flatbed Die Cutting Machines Work?
In flatbed die cutting, the material is fed onto a stationary bed, and a die is pressed down onto the material with the force of a hydraulic press. The die cuts the material into the desired shape.

7. Punch Die Cutting Machines
What Are Punch Die Cutting Machines?
Punch die cutting machines are typically used for creating perforations, notches, or small shapes in materials. They are ideal for applications like ticket cutting, fabric perforation, and even the creation of gaskets.
How Do Punch Die Cutting Machines Work?
In punch die cutting, the die punches out shapes from the material as it moves through the machine. This type of die cutting is most often used in applications where the goal is to remove small sections of the material.
